The NME have reviewed the new album by Black Affair (Steve Mason’s current project) in this week’s issue - scoring it 8/10
Camillia Pia’s review describes the album as “shimmering electro-funk that tells sultry tales of dark obsession and kinky copulation” and “A brilliantly tense and often remarkable record”
